One of the key roles of a landlord & tenant lawyer is to help draft and review rental agreements. These legal documents outline the terms and conditions of the rental agreement, including rent payments, lease duration, and responsibilities of both the landlord and tenant. A lawyer can ensure that the agreement complies with local rental laws and regulations, protecting the rights of both parties involved.
In addition to drafting rental agreements, a landlord & tenant lawyer can also provide legal advice and representation in the event of a dispute between the landlord and tenant. Common issues that may arise include non-payment of rent, property damage, breach of lease terms, or eviction proceedings. A lawyer can help negotiate a resolution between the parties, or represent their client in court if necessary.
For landlords, a landlord & tenant lawyer can assist with eviction proceedings. Evicting a tenant can be a complex and time-consuming process, with strict legal requirements that must be followed. A lawyer can ensure that all proper procedures are followed, from serving the appropriate notice to filing the necessary paperwork with the court. In the event that the case goes to trial, a lawyer can represent the landlord in court and argue their case before a judge.
On the other hand, tenants who are facing eviction can also benefit from the services of a landlord & tenant lawyer. A lawyer can review the eviction notice and rental agreement to determine if the eviction is legal and valid. They can also help negotiate with the landlord to reach a resolution and prevent eviction, or represent the tenant in court to challenge the eviction and protect their rights.
